Since 1992, we have surveyed 10 other locations in the Chesapeake watershed. These catfish from the South River have the highest skin tumor rate and second highest liver tumor rate.
We collected 30 fish from the South River near Annapolis last year. Sixteen fish had raised, pinkish red lesions around the mouth.
In the South River we have not established a link between the tumors and PAH exposure.
The fish are clearly exposed to cancer-causing agents, and at this point, we really don't know what chemicals are responsible. We suspect it's from (polluted) runoff.
